Binary package hint: overlay-scrollbar

When there is a lot of content in the window, the scrollbar activation
area is very small. You move your mouse to the right of the screen to
pick up the scrollbar, but it doesn't show (just the window resize). You
have to find the 'tiny orange' part and get your mouse all the way over
to that. See attached screenshot: the orange part is on the bottom
right.

Another irritation is that when the scroll-bar activation part appears,
it isn't always under the mouse, so you have to move your mouse to the
orange to get the scrollbar, then move it again before clicking on it.
It should always appear right under the mouse.
